ASP技术精析与安全实战全攻略
|
本视觉设计由AI辅助,仅供参考 ASP技术作为早期Web开发的重要基石,至今仍在一些遗留系统中发挥着关键作用。其核心在于动态生成网页内容,通过服务器端脚本实现与用户交互的灵活性。在实际应用中,ASP依赖于VBScript或JScript等脚本语言,结合HTML标签完成页面渲染。这种混合模式使得开发者能够快速构建功能丰富的网页,但也带来了潜在的安全隐患。 常见的ASP安全问题包括注入攻击、跨站脚本(XSS)和文件包含漏洞。例如,若未对用户输入进行严格过滤,攻击者可能通过构造恶意SQL语句操控数据库,造成数据泄露或篡改。 防范措施应从源头入手,如使用参数化查询替代字符串拼接,避免直接执行用户输入。同时,合理配置服务器权限,限制对敏感文件的访问,能有效降低风险。 在实战中,渗透测试是检验ASP系统安全性的重要手段。通过模拟攻击行为,可以发现代码逻辑缺陷或配置错误,为后续加固提供依据。 定期更新依赖库和框架,关闭不必要的服务,也是提升整体安全性的关键步骤。即使系统运行稳定,也不能忽视长期维护的重要性。 对于开发者而言,掌握ASP安全最佳实践,不仅有助于规避常见威胁,还能提升代码质量与可维护性。安全无小事,需时刻保持警惕。 (编辑:草根网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330470号